Cell Proliferation | 1972

THE LYMPHOCYTES OF CHRONIC LYMPHOCYTIC LEUKEMIA: THEIR PROLIFERATION AND CELL CYCLE KINETICS

L. Ione Johnson; Joseph LoBue; Arnold D. Rubin

Lymphocytes obtained from CLL patients exhibited a delayed and reduced response to PHA when cultured in diffusion chambers. DNA synthesis (8–10 hr) and general time (15–19 hr) of the late‐developing CLL blasts were consistent with normal values (Ts: 8–10 hr; Tc: 14–17 hr). However, the G2 period of CLL blasts seemed more variable, and their mitotic index during the response at 5–6 days was 30–50% of the values determined for normal blasts during their peak response at 2–3 days.


Experimental Biology and Medicine | 1969

Autoradiographic Studies of Human Lymphocytes Cultured in Vivo

L. Ione Johnson; Joseph LoBue; P-Chuen Chan; Francis C. Monette; Arnold D. Rubin; Albert S. Gordon; William Dameshek

Summary Human lymphocytes were cultured in diffusion chambers implanted into the peritoneal cavities of rats. In cultures treated with PHA, the pattern of morphologic transformation and initiation of DNA synthesis paralleled closely similar studies made in vitro. Immunologic stimulation of the human cells by the heterologous host was presumably minimal or absent since control cultures (without PHA) showed no significant degree of blastogenesis when compared with PHA-treated cultures. Minimum DNA synthesis time determined for the PHA-stimulated lymphocytes was 9–10 hr. Values found for the duration of Tc (16–18 hr) and minimum TG2 (2 hr) were shorter than those reported for similar studies in vitro. The in vivo culture method using Millipore chambers appears to offer a more physiologic method for studying lymphocytes.


Experimental Biology and Medicine | 1970

Growth Characteristics of the Shay Chloroleukemia in Diffusion Chambers

Philip Ferris; Joseph LoBue; Albert S. Gordon

Summary Chloroleukemic cells placed within diffusion chambers grew at a fairly uniform rate in both rats and mice. Both mitotic indices and mitotic times (about 40 min) were the same in all chambers regardless of the number of cells in the initial population. The numbers of cells declined moderately during the first 48 hr and increased slowly until harvest on Day 7.
